List the options available in a Care Area record's Linked
ADT Arrival Status field and explain what that field affects.
- Answer-Expected: Sets the ADT Status of patients
placed in this care area to Expected. Waiting: Sets the
ADT Status of patients placed in this care area to Waiting.
Roomed: Sets the ADT Status of patients placed in this
care area to Roomed.
This field also filters what types of care areas you will be
able to add into the Department record in text. For
example, you may not add a Care Area with a Roomed
ADT Arrival Status in the Expected Care Area section of
your Department record.

In the In-Class Exercises for this chapter, in the first four
Care Area records we built, we left the ED Manager View
field blank. However, when we tested our build, we saw
that columns were indeed displaying for those care areas
in the ED Manager. How is that possible? - Answer-The
ED Manager View field in a Care Area record is an
override to the default view specified in the profile. When
we tested our build in class, we logged in as the nurse on
our info sheets. The nurse's user records are linked to a
profile that has a default Manager view specified.
Whenever we log in to our ED, Hyperspace first consults
our Care Area records to see whether a view is attached.
If not, it uses the profile view.

Define the following term - ToolTip - Answer-ToolTip Label
- The label that displays with the information in the tooltip
when a user rests the mouse pointer over a patient's
name.
Tooltip Extension - A record containing code that accesses
the information for the tooltip when a user rests the mouse
over a patient's name on the ED Manager or ED Map.
Define the following term - View - Answer-A View record
(LVW) is a collection of columns used to present
information on the ED tracking tools that appear on ASAP
users' home activities. View records can be embedded
within the ED Manager, the Track Board, and the Unit Map

True or False: Each Room record may contain only one
Bed record. - Answer-False; while Epic recommends
maintaining a 1:1 room and bed ratio, multiple bed records
can be linked to a room record.
